Building a sustainable global economy: The challenge to higher education 

Climate change has a direct impact on the world’s economies. Damage from severe weather is costly and imposes burdens on governmental and corporate budgets. Yet, despite mounting negative impacts, there is a continuing struggle to build a more sustainable global economy. Global supply chains – the backbone of thriving economies -- are experiencing uncertainty, buffeted by financial crises, regionalization and geopolitical factors that stand in the way of adopting sustainable, climate-friendly practices.

 
Through targeted research, teaching and learning, the world’s universities can mitigate these factors and play a key role in driving a global shift to sustainability.
